The Role:
The Account Coordinator will provide production and sales support to the Account Management team as well as manage existing events and client relationships. The Account Coordinator will initiate sales and design delivery within events and exhibitions while meeting budgeted sales targets.
Key Responsibilities include;
- Source new clients through industry networking, established contacts and maintaining an awareness of upcoming bids and tenders.
- Maintain strong relationships with existing clients and stakeholders.
- Up-sell and cross-sell all parts of the business. Involve staff from other divisions when necessary to help with clients requirements.
- Attend site inspections. Incorporate Sales Staff from other divisions best suited to the client’s requirements.
- Prepare floor plans and detailed drawings including an operations schedule information sheet and / or site map with a diagram.
- Prepare and distribute a comprehensive schedule incorporating all critical timings and people involved.
- Ensure all sub-hired equipment is ordered on a timely basis.
- Provide organisers with necessary legal documentation.
- Ensure timely and accurate invoicing of the event after completion, including any changes/additions during the event. Process payment for balance owing.
